Two-Day Itinerary for Croog Madkeri in June 2023

  1. Day 1: Madikeri Fort
    5 minutes (0.6 miles) from Raja's Seat

    In the morning, visit the Madikeri Fort, a historical landmark built by Mudduraja in the 17th century. Explore the palace, museum, and the breathtaking views of the surrounding hills. In the afternoon, head to Raja's Seat, a popular garden with stunning views of the valley. Relax and enjoy the sunset. In the evening, visit the Omkareshwara Temple, a unique mix of Gothic and Islamic architecture, and witness the evening aarti.

  2. Day 2: Abbey Falls
    30 minutes (6.7 miles) from Madikeri Fort

    In the morning, visit Abbey Falls, a picturesque wa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. Take a refreshing dip in the natural pool and enjoy the scenic beauty. In the afternoon, head to Dubare Elephant Camp, an elephant training camp located on the banks of the river Cauvery. Interact with elephants, take a ride on their backs, and learn about their behavior, habitat, and conservation. In the evening, visit the Talacauvery Temple, the origin of the river Cauvery, and witness the evening aarti.

Recommendations

If you have extra time, visit the Namdroling Monastery, a Tibetan Buddhist monastery with stunning architecture and exquisite paintings. You can also go trekking in the Brahmagiri Hills or visit the Nagarhole National Park for a wildlife safari. Do not miss trying the local delicacies, such as pandi curry and bamboo shoot curry.
